Синхронизация сайта с xml
1.Необходимо на моём сайте ohotar.com сделать синхронизацию (импорт) с прайсом поставщика который идёт в формате .xml Мой сайт написан на "okcms" (переделанная симпла), в нём есть импорт/экспорт но только с файлом .csv
Мне необходимо обучить сайт работать с файлом .xml и синхронизировать позиции на сайте с позициями в прайсе поставщика из его файла. Необходимо проверить наличие товара на складе поставщика и обновить для него цену по специальной формуле (например, если цена от 0 до 100грн то умножить на 1,5, а если ...). Думаю понадобиться какая то таблица где будет указано какой артикул поставщика соответствует моему артикулу. Её я могу либо заполнить в экселе и импортировать на сайт, либо сайт должен сам сделать привязку если товар новый и он его себе создаёт.
2.Так же, необходимо сделать возможность импортировать из прайса поставщика данные о товаре (описание, характеристики, ссылки на картинки и т.д.). Для товаров которые отсутствуют у меня на сайте необходимо сделать возможность создания этого товара.
Я это представляю как настроенная синхронизация у меня на сайте, где у каждой синхронизации будет указана ссылка с каким файлом нужно работать, какие теги из файла чему соответствуют на моём сайте. Автоматически (думаю чере крон) будет проходить только обновление цен и наличия, а добавления на мой сайт новых позиций я буду делать только в ручную (указывать какие товары из какой папки поставщика создавать), или вообще вывести весь прайс поставщика в экселевский, а потом я импортирую его насайт стандартным способом.
По сути, мне необходим посредник в моём импорте, так как мой сайт может импортировать товары из файла .csv то при импорте из .xml необходимо указать сайту что означает информация из тегов в файле .xml, а дальше импорт как со стандартным .csv. Может даже просто превращать .xml в .csv по моим настройкам и дальше автоматически подтянуть на сайт используя стандартный импорт.
Может у вас есть другие варианты, более простые.
Прикрепляю примерный фай, хочу подчеркнуть, что у каждого поставщика свои теги, так что для каждого другого поставщика мне необходимо будет указать какие теги чему соответствуют на моём сайте.
Не прикрепляется, запрещено почему то.
-
3070 53 1 Добрый день.
Делал уже подобный парсер, именно из xml и именно для OkayCMS
Обращайтесь
-
142 Здравствуйте, это будет моя первая работа на freelancehunt, и я готов выполнить ее на самом высоком уровне.Я готов адаптироваться к вашим условиям.
-
2791 43 0 Готов сделать программу которая будет парсить информацию из xml и на ее основе формировать csv.
-
322 22 0 1 Готов сотрудничать пишите в ЛС обсудим детали.
Готов сотрудничать пишите в ЛС обсудим детали.
Готов сотрудничать пишите в ЛС обсудим детали.
Current freelance projects in the category Content Management Systems
Setting up a fabric online store on WordPress + WooCommerce using the Astra template
330 USD
It is necessary to set up and prepare an online store for furniture fabrics for the Norwegian market. The domain, hosting, and WordPress are already installed: eximtextilnordiq.com The site should not be created from scratch and without custom programming, but on the ready-made… Content Management Systems, HTML & CSS ∙ 1 hour 52 minutes back ∙ 35 proposals |
Remove code duplication of analytics in the Okay CMS website code.
22 USD
It is necessary to remove the duplicated analytics code on the site using Okay CMS. Experience specifically with Okay CMS is required. Content Management Systems, Web Programming ∙ 1 hour 58 minutes back ∙ 32 proposals |
Create a page in Elementor WP based on the example + formInterested in the price for creating a page on Elementor WP based on the example https://sunone.com.ua/ru/autsorsing-gruzchikov/ + in this style a form Content Management Systems ∙ 3 hours 39 minutes back ∙ 30 proposals |
Updating WP plugins and themes on the site putevka.uzThere is a serious problem with plugins on the site putevka.uz, lack of licenses for paid ones, old versions with vulnerabilities: 1. Critically outdated or problematic (Needs urgent resolution) These plugins create the greatest risks for security, performance, or stability.… Content Management Systems, Web Programming ∙ 4 hours 41 minutes back ∙ 41 proposals |
New website for sto-vag.com.uaWe want to update the website of our small auto service center. Currently, it is 1 page, and we want to make it multi-page. The CMS will be chosen by the contractor. For us, the main points are: - fast website loading - cross-browser compatibility - good mobile version The… Content Management Systems, Web Programming ∙ 17 hours 7 minutes back ∙ 113 proposals |